Businesses who take environmental, social and corporate governance (ESG) seriously can transform entire markets, industries and economies worldwide. Learn how to think critically about ESG to ensure your company remains profitable long term.
ESG goes beyond decarbonization commitments, corporate goals, industry awards and the balance sheet. It cuts at the core of business. Managing this effort requires courage, imagination and careful analysis to supplement what is already working at a company and change what isn't. This change involves open communication surrounding environmental sustainability, people and processes. It requires that key decision makers think about ESG across and outside the business, including in daily business practices, communication with stakeholders, financial considerations, the integration of new technologies and products.
The ESG Mindset guides business leaders, ESG specialists and CSR strategists through the nuanced and most thoughtful ways to focus on these core business issues. Equipping readers with an enhanced way to tackle complex business decisions, the book provides accessible perspectives and case studies from Fortune 500 companies that have implemented a meaningful approach to ESG. Readers will learn how to think about pressing ESG challenges in new ways and determine the best ways to future-proof a business.
